Stan Vanderbeek's Poemfield series was produced between 1964 and 1970 using one of the first computer animation languages, Ken Knowlton's BEFLIX (short for Bell Labs Flicks). Each individual film is concerned with the appearance of language on a computer screen: sequences of words gradually emerge from, and back into, kinetic mosaics of glittering geometric graphics. In Poemfield No. 2, "these words shift and mutate, fracture and fragment, to travel down the screen in a laconic calligraphy. The viewer reads them, but it is impossible not to see them as well: they remain shapes, images, pictures. The color is psychedelic. The underscoring technology, computational. The presentation is cinematic. Yet the artist presents the work as, simply, a poem." (Zabet Patterson)
